Quote:
Originally Posted by BuckeyeCub
Would like my parents find out if I did such a thing? Like would it show up somewhere
|
I've never used one, so I'm not sure on all of the details. If you search for "prepaid visa" there is plenty of info out there.
It appears that you can purchase a "VISA gift card" at banks, grocery stores, drug stores, etc. and these can be used like a credit card, but with virtually no strings attached.
Here is a link to all of the VISA prepaid options.
(The linked site would not work for me in Firefox, if that's what you are using.)